      Godda College, Godda Admission Process

      Godda College, Godda, is an esteemed college situated in Punsiya, Jharkhand, under the jurisdiction of the Jharkhand State Government. Godda College's admission process is transparent in its entire admission system and very rational in its approach to selecting students for a myriad of undergraduate and postgraduate courses in the sciences and humanities. Godda College admission process is a NAAC-accredited institution and has also been approved by the National Council for Teacher Education (NCTE), which bout guarantees the quality of education being imparted to its students. Godda College usually starts the admission process before the commencement of each academic year. Godda College admission process is based mostly on the merit of the qualifying examination score or entrance test score, as per the programme under consideration.

      The Godda College admission process maintains a very transparent and unambiguous selection process in accordance with its constitution, as laid down by the state government, UT, and the university to which it is affiliated. The eligibility criteria depend on the programme selected. Godda College admission process for undergraduate courses, a candidate must have passed or appeared for an examination of 10+2 from a recognised board. A relevant bachelor's degree needs to be possessed by postgraduate applicants. Some courses may also stipulate other specific requirements, including B.Sc. in Zoology, Botany, Chemistry, or Physics. Godda College admission process for the B.Ed. programme, among others, possesses a broader admission process, often accompanied by an entrance examination along with marks obtained at the qualifying course.

      Godda College Application Processes

      The complete processes for admission at Godda College, Godda, are as follows:

      • Notification: The college shall make admission notifications available on its official website and in local newspapers about starting the admission process for various programmes.
      • Application Form: The candidates have to obtain the application form and fill it up. It may be made available online by the college on its website or it can be directly bought from the college admission office.
      • Entrance Exam/Merit list: For most courses, merit lists are prepared based on the marks obtained in the qualifying examination. An entrance examination may also be conducted for the B.Ed. programme.
      • Counselling and Document Verification: Candidates who have been shortlisted are called for counselling and document verification. This is a crucial step to ascertain the authenticity of the documents submitted and also to provide specific programme information to candidates.
      • Fee Payment: Following verification and seat allotment, candidates should pay the prescribed admission fee to secure a seat.
      • Enrolment: Once the fee has been deposited, candidates will be officially enrolled in the Godda College programme of their choice.

      Godda College B.Sc. Admission Process

      Godda College offers B.Sc. Programmes (Zoology, Botany, Chemistry, Physics). Admissions to B.Sc. programmes with honours are based on the merit of the candidate's performance in the 10+2 examination. The college offers specialised honours courses in Zoology, Botany, Chemistry, and Physics. Candidates must have studied the relevant science subjects in their 10+2 education.

      Godda College B.A. Admission Process

      Godda College offers B.A. Programmes (Economics, Geography, Santali). For B.A. programmes with honours in Economics, Geography, and Santali, admissions are granted based on the marks obtained in the 10+2 examination. Candidates should have studied relevant subjects in their higher secondary education.

      Godda College M.A. Economics Admission Process

      Godda College offers an M.A. Economics programme. Admission to the M.A. Economics programme is typically based on the candidate's performance in their bachelor's degree, preferably in Economics or a related field. The selection process may include consideration of the graduation marks and possibly an entrance test or interview.

      Godda College M.Sc. Zoology Admission Process

      Godda College offers an M.Sc. Zoology programme. For the M.Sc. Zoology programme, candidates with a B.Sc. degree in Zoology or related life sciences are eligible. The admission is likely based on the merit of their undergraduate performance and may include an entrance test or interview.

      Godda College B.Ed. Admission Process

      Godda College offers B.Ed. Programme. The B.Ed. programme at Godda College has an approved intake of 100 students. Admission to this programme follows a broader process. As stated in the college's admission procedure, "Admission shall be made on merit on the basis of marks obtained in the qualifying examination and/or in the entrance examination or any other selection process as per the policy of the state government/U.T. Administration and the university."

      Godda College Document Process

      • Mark sheets and certificates of the 10th and 12th
      • Graduation mark sheets and degree certificate (for postgraduate courses)
      • Character certificate from the last-attended institution
      • Migration certificate (if applicable)
      • Caste certificate (for reserved category candidates)
      • Recent passport-size photographs
